    It sounds crazy but that's the way it's supposed to be. It's the same on the original Uni-Vibe. "Chorus" is actually the traditional Uni-Vibe sound (used by Hendrix, Gilmour, etc.) that's ironically much like a throbbing PHASER (phrasing). Vibe is an abbreviation for vibrato which is actually the modulated signal that's mixed with the dry guitar signal to produce a CHORUS effect. However there is no dry signal in the mix so you only hear the wavering effect - hence vibrato like bending a sting up and down repeatedly. Why they named the Uni-Vibey phaser-like mode "Chorus" is beyond me but they actually did get the Vibe setting accurately named. So in conclusion, don't do what Donny Don't does. (They could have made this clearer.)
